If a 10.17-g sample of solid sodium bicarbonate the active ingredient in baking soda completely decomposes into solid sodium hydroxide with carbon dioxide gas when heated. After the sodium hydroxide cools, it has a mass of 4.84 g. As per to the law of conservation of mass, define what mass of carbon dioxide must have been formed?
